Claim: The video shows Congress chief Mallikarjun Kharge being asked to stay outside while Priyanka Gandhi files her nomination for the Wayanad by-election.
Fact: The claim is false. An extended video shows all leaders, including Kharge, being present for the nomination process.

Hyderabad: The political atmosphere in Kerala’s Wayanad is heating up as the by-election approaches with Congress candidate Priyanka Gandhi being one of the top candidates contesting. Voting for the Wayanad Lok Sabha constituency is scheduled for November 13, 2024.

Amid this backdrop, social media has been buzzing with claims that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ge was left out during Priyanka’s nomination filing on October 23. Users allege that only her husband and son accompanied Priyanka to the Wayanad district collector’s office, while Kharge was reportedly kept outside. A video circulating shows Kharge standing outside a door which has added fuel to these speculations.

BJP leader Rajeev Chandrasekhar shared the video and wrote, “Where were you @kharge Saheb? When first family Priyanka Vadra ji was filing her nomination as Cong candidate for #Wayanad. Kept outside because he is not family. Self-respect and dignity were sacrificed at the altar of arrogance and entitlement of the Sonia family. Just imagine if they treat a senior Dalit leader and party president like this, how they will treat the people of Wayanad.”


Fact Check

NewsMeter found that the claim was false. All leaders, including Kharge, were present in the collector’s chamber while Priyanka Gandhi was filing her nomination.

We began our investigation by examining the Kerala Congress Facebook page, where we found several images of Priyanka filing her nomination in the collector’s office. These images clearly show her brother, Rahul Gandhi and Mallikarjun Kharge present with her. The Facebook post also mentioned that Sonia Gandhi, KC Venugopal and Panakkad Sayyid Sadiq Ali Shihab Thangal were present with them.


To verify further, we reviewed an extended video on the ANI YouTube channel that captures almost the entire nomination submission process.

At the beginning of the 20-minute video, Priyanka Gandhi appears with her husband and son. At the 4:35-minute mark, they exit, followed by the entry of Mallikarjun Kharge and Rahul Gandhi. Later, as KC Venugopal joins, the collector is heard stating at the 6:25-minute mark that only five people are permitted. This indicated that due to restrictions on the number of attendees during the nomination process, not everyone could enter the chamber initially.


We also checked the election commission guidelines, which clearly stated that the maximum number of individuals allowed to enter the office of the returning officer or the assistant returning officer during the nomination filing is limited to five, including the candidate.


NewsMeter also spoke with a local journalist who was present during the nomination.

“The claim that Mallikarjun Kharge was kept outside during Priyanka Gandhi’s nomination is false. At first, Priyanka went into the collector’s chamber with her husband, son and Sonia Gandhi. Rahul Gandhi and Mallikarjun Kharge came in later. Since only five people, including the candidate, are allowed in the chamber at one time, that’s why Kharge and Rahul were outside. Towards the end of the process, Priyanka’s husband and son stepped out, which then allowed Rahul and Kharge to come in. They were just following the election commission’s rules. Any other claims are not true,” he confirmed.

Hence, we conclude that the claim that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ge was kept outside during Congress candidate Priyanka Gandhi’s nomination submission for the Wayanad by-election is false.
